Bouncin' Bosons

Scientists have discovered methods in quantum mechanics that break the equivalence principle. That being, according to Einstein (via the article), "the gravitational force we experience on Earth is identical to the force we would experience were we sitting in a spaceship accelerating at 1g." Turns out that with a clever combination of gravitational and electromagnetic boxes and oscillators, well, it ain't so.
